Price a consulting policy and you learn quickly that the number tracks your contracts, not your square footage. General Liability for this trade starts around $35 a month, because the physical exposure is genuinely small: a visitor trips, a client's monitor goes over at your desk, and the sums stay ordinary. The advice side does not stay ordinary, which is why the two lines sit at different price points. Consulting insurance in Macon ends up being a bundle question more than a single-product question. Revenue, client concentration, and the industries you serve do most of the work in a quote. A practice with three clients carries a different risk shape than one with thirty, and carriers in Georgia read that concentration straight off the application. Sort those facts before you compare anything.
What Makes Macon Different
Thin markets push consultants into broader work, and breadth is what makes underwriters cautious. The practice doing strategy, systems selection, and interim management carries three separate risk profiles. A small local economy will rarely support one narrow specialty for the length of a career. So you widen across Bibb County, and the application question about services performed gets longer. A longer answer often means a higher rate, or an exclusion participating carriers in Georgia attach. Read any exclusion carefully, because it can quietly remove the work you actually do most. If a service is a small share of your billing, consider whether it earns its premium. Dropping one line of work can be the least expensive coverage decision available to you.
Local Risk Factors in Macon
Before storm season, ask two questions of your practice. Where does the work live if the office is gone by morning, and who must be told when your dates move? Consultants survive severe weather on continuity rather than on claims, because the property at risk is a laptop and the thing genuinely at risk is a deadline. A business owners policy may respond to damaged business property in Macon, subject to your deductible and to what the form says about that specific peril. The larger risk is a client whose own site is wrecked and whose project money quietly disappears, and no coverage in Georgia answers for that. Milestone billing does.
What Coverage Does a Consulting in Macon Need?
Professional Liability
A client acts on your recommendation, the numbers land badly, and they argue the advice caused the loss. That claim is what Professional Liability is meant for, including the defense cost that starts before anyone agrees on the facts. It generally will not answer bodily injury or damage to someone's property, and it typically excludes work you already knew was wrong when you delivered it.
Example: You recommend a vendor migration, the client's order system stalls for a fortnight, and their counsel sends a demand letter naming your report. A claims-made policy in force at that moment may be asked to respond.
General Liability
Landlords, coworking operators, and client procurement teams ask for proof of this line before they hand over a key or a vendor number. It addresses third-party bodily injury and damage to someone else's property, which for a consultant usually means an accident during a meeting on their floor. Claims about the quality of your advice sit outside it entirely.
Example: Your bag catches a client's monitor at the edge of a conference table and it lands on the tile. The repair claim that follows could fall to this line, subject to your deductible.
Cyber Liability
Ordinary business bundles rarely treat exposed client files as a covered loss, and that gap is why this line exists. Cyber Liability is intended for what follows a breach: forensics, notification duties, and claims from clients whose material sat in your shared drive. What your application said about backups and access control can decide whether a claim in Macon is accepted.
Example: A phishing message copies your login, and a folder of client interviews leaves the drive overnight. The notification bills and forensic work that follow are the sort of costs this line is built to take on.
Business Owners Policy
Desks, monitors, drives, and the small room they sit in are what a business owners policy bundles, alongside the ordinary premises liability that comes with having a place clients visit. The bundle is inexpensive relative to what it addresses, and it stays silent on advice claims, which is the loss most likely to reach a consultant.
Example: A pipe lets go above your rented ceiling in Macon and takes down two monitors and a box of printed interview notes. Property loss like that is generally where this bundle earns its keep.
How Much Does Consulting Insurance Cost in Macon?
Consulting Insurance is a bundle of separate policies, priced separately. The ranges below are typical figures for Macon for each line; a quote prices each one against your own operations.
| Coverage | Typical range | What moves your price |
|---|---|---|
| Professional Liability Insurance | $85 - $310 per month | The services you actually perform, annual revenue or billed fees, limit and retention selected |
| General Liability Insurance | $35 - $100 per month | Industry and risk classification, annual revenue, number of employees |
| Cyber Liability Insurance | $35 - $130 per month | Records held and how sensitive they are, annual revenue and industry, multi-factor authentication and backup practices |
| Business Owners Policy Insurance | $45 - $150 per month | Annual revenue and industry class, building and contents values, square footage and building age |
Prices shown are general estimates, not guaranteed rates or quotes. Your actual premium will depend on the insurer, coverage selected, business details, location, claims history, and other underwriting factors.
What Are the Insurance Requirements for a Consulting in Macon?
Workers' comp is generally required once you have 3 or more employees. Georgia generally requires employers to carry workers' compensation at that point. Common exemptions include sole proprietors, partners, and corporate officers. Confirm current thresholds with your state's workers' compensation agency before you hire.
Flood damage is typically excluded from standard policies. Standard commercial property and builders-risk-type policies typically exclude flood damage. Flood exposure varies address by address, so check your premises in FEMA's Flood Map Service Center before deciding; if you sit in a mapped flood zone, a separate policy through the National Flood Insurance Program is the usual starting point.
Where to verify licensing and coverage rules. The Georgia Office of Insurance and Safety Fire Commissioner publishes consumer guidance and current insurance requirements for Georgia businesses. When a contract or lease demands specific wording, the Georgia Office of Insurance and Safety Fire Commissioner's guidance is the authoritative place to check.

How to Buy: Advice for Macon Owners
Compare on structure before you compare on price. Two Professional Liability quotes for a Macon practice can share a limit and still differ on the retroactive date, on whether defense erodes that limit, and on what counts as a claim. One of them may exclude the exact service that pays your bills, and you would find out at the worst possible moment. Read the exclusions first, then the definitions, then the number. A business owners policy is easier to compare, because bundles vary less, and it still will not answer an advice claim. Rules are state-specific, so check the Georgia Office of Insurance and Safety Fire Commissioner's guidance before deciding what you must carry. Then compare quotes from participating carriers with the exclusion pages open in front of you rather than the summary sheet.
